Covestro, Fertiglobe, and TA'ZIZ Sign MoU for Low-Carbon Ammonia Collaboration

AMMONIA

Covestro, Fertiglobe, and TA'ZIZ sign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) to explore collaboration in the ammonia and nitric acid value chains. The partnership will focus on securing low-carbon ammonia for Covestro's facilities in China and the U.S., while evaluating longer-term supply options for Europe, China, and the U.S.

The agreement includes assessing infrastructure needs and aims to support Covestro's transition to lower-emission manufacturing of MDI and TDI. The MoU signifies strategic alignment within XRG's Global Chemicals platform following XRG's acquisition of Covestro in December 2025.
